Galaxy Ace 3, with Android 4.2, now with 4G support

Galaxy Ace 3, with Android 4.2
We have just been officially told that the Galaxy line of Samsung is complemented by the successor of the Samsung Galaxy Ace 2.

This, according to Samsung, super fast 4G phones has a 1.2 GHz dual-core processor and a 4 inch screen. The screen is thus 0.2 inch larger than its predecessor, but the resolution of 480x800 pixels is unchanged. The dual-core processor is clocked slightly higher; the Galaxy Ace 2 is still at 800MHz. Furthermore, the 5 mega pixel camera remained unchanged and includes the Ace 3 software as "Sound & Shot ',' Best Photo 'and' Buddy Photo Share '. At the front is to be found. A VGA camera the storage memory is increased from 4 GB to 8 GB available may be expanded with a microSD card up to 64GB. The RAM is increased from 768MB to 1GB. The battery has been upgraded from 1500 mAh to 1800 mAh.

The dimensions are 121.2 x 62.7 x 10 mm and weight is 119.5 grams. This is the Galaxy Ace 3 slightly longer and slightly heavier than its predecessor.

Samsung has the Ace 3 an update with the 4G technology. With the Galaxy Ace 3 so you can surf the 4G network being rolled out.

Software
Samsung has also added a number of features on the Galaxy Ace 3 which should enable the user. Easy some functions have been around the Galaxy S 4.
• S Translator: provides instant translations, at any time of the day
• S Travel: you always travel information at hand
• Smart Stay: recognize your face when you look on your smartphone and saves battery power by dimming the screen when you look away
• S Voice: for executing voice commands
• 'Easy Mode': Aim your home screen so that you have easy access to the features that you will find the most important
3 The Ace comes with Android 4.2.
